Transaction 03106dd57856e1c029ff3af1b8510e34bbe16f2908de7e720dc1ec59bac1d23c
1 Input
1 Output
-
03106dd57856e1c029ff3af1b8510e34bbe16f2908de7e720dc1ec59bac1d23c:0
- value
- 161503
- script pubkey
- OP_0 OP_PUSHBYTES_32 0efa9ae9a0d09d29c03b3a850065a911bd6b5f0aaeee5c5a1e5a70025189906e
- address
- bc1qpmaf46dq6zwjnspm82zsqedfzx7kkhc24mh9cks7tfcqy5vfjphqt0x3hy